Nom
|
Nom de l'élément. Il doit s'agir d'un nom clair et explicite, qui permette à des
utilisateurs non spécialistes de savoir à quoi sert l'élément.
|
Code
|
Nom technique de l'élément. Ce nom est utilisé pour la génération de code ou de scripts. Il peut avoir une forme abrégée et il est préférable qu'il ne contienne pas d'espace.
|
Commentaire
|
Libellé descriptif de la règle.
|
Stéréotype
|
Sous-classification utilisée pour étendre la sémantique d'un objet sans changer sa structure ; peut être prédéfini ou bien défini par l'utilisateur.
|
Type
|
Spécifie la nature de la règle de gestion. Vous pouvez choisir une des options
suivantes :
-
Contrainte – contrainte de contrôle sur une valeur. Par exemple, "La
date de début doit être antérieure à la date de fin d'un projet". Dans un MPD, les règles de
gestion de contrainte attachées aux tables et aux colonnes sont générées. Si le SGBD prend en charge l'utilisation de plusieurs contraintes, les règles de contrainte sont générées sous la forme d'instructions de contraintes distinctes portant le nom de la règle.
-
Définition – propriété de l'élément dans le système. Par exemple; "Un client est identifié par un nom et une adresse".
-
Fait – certitude dans le système. Par exemple, "Un client peut passer une ou plusieurs commandes".
-
Formule – calcule. Par exemple, "Le total des commandes est égal à la somme de toutes les commandes".
-
Besoin – spécification fonctionnelle. Par exemple, "Le modèle est conçu de telle manière que les pertes totales ne dépassent pas 10% du volume total des ventes".
-
Validation – contrainte sur une valeur. Par exemple, "La somme des commandes
d'un client ne doit pas être supérieure au plafond autorisé pour ce
client". Dans un MPD, les règles de validation liées aux tables ou aux colonnes sont générées comme faisant partie de la contrainte primaire pour la table ou la colonne.
|